How Do Casinos Make Money?

A casino is a place where gambling games like poker, blackjack, roulette and slots are played. It’s also where world class restaurants, spas and entertainment are on the menu too. Casinos often add luxuries like hotels, free drinks and stage shows to help attract visitors but the bulk of their profits come from gambling activities. Gambling has been legalized in many countries and casino resorts are now a major tourist attraction. In the past, casinos were controlled by mob families but with federal crackdowns and the threat of losing their gaming license at the slightest hint of mob involvement, they have had to reorganize and become more corporate. This has led to a huge growth in the business with the addition of a wide variety of games and perks designed to attract gamblers and reward them for their business.
